How to Create Multilingual AI Videos: Step-by-Step

Illustration: how to create multilingual ai videos

Follow this proven 2026 workflow to produce professional multilingual videos with AI:

  1. Choose your base content - Record live-action footage or generate AI video using platforms like Digen AI, Synthesia, or Wayin AI
  2. Select target languages - Most 2026 tools support 30+ languages; prioritize based on your audience demographics
  3. Configure voice parameters - Adjust age, gender, and speaking style for each language version
  4. Run AI dubbing - Modern systems like Wayin AI complete this in 3-7 minutes per language
  5. Review automated subtitles - AI generates time-coded captions with 92% accuracy (2026 benchmarks)
  6. Export localized versions - Download separate files or use API integration for direct publishing

Optimizing AI Video Translation Quality

how to create multilingual ai videos workflow

While AI handles most of the heavy lifting, these 2026 best practices ensure professional results:

1. Source Audio Quality Matters

Clean recordings with minimal background noise improve translation accuracy by 17% according to Synthesia's 2026 whitepaper. Even when generating AI avatars, starting with high-quality voice samples yields better multilingual outputs.

2. Contextualize Your Translations

Leading tools now offer "translation notes" fields where you can explain cultural references, jokes, or industry terms. The Charleston Gazette-Mail's tutorial shows how this simple step reduces awkward translations by 63%.

3. Review Auto-Generated Subtitles

While AI caption accuracy has reached 92% for major languages (Wayin AI stats), always verify timing and line breaks. The best 2026 tools provide editable caption tracks that maintain sync across all language versions.

Frequently Asked Questions

How accurate is AI video translation compared to human translators?

Modern AI achieves 89-93% accuracy for common language pairs according to 2026 benchmarks, though human review is still recommended for nuanced content. Emotional tone preservation has improved dramatically, with Wayin AI reporting 91% accuracy in maintaining sarcasm and humor cues.

Can AI handle languages with completely different sentence structures?

Yes, 2026's context-aware systems perform significantly better with structural differences. For example, Japanese-to-English translations now maintain proper subject-verb-object order 87% of the time versus just 62% in 2025 (Generative AI in the Newsroom data).

How long does multilingual AI video production take?

Most 2026 tools can dub a 5-minute video in 3-7 minutes per language. Full generation of new multilingual content takes longer - Digen AI Agent averages 22 minutes for a 10-minute video across 5 languages due to its quality optimization steps.

Do I need separate video files for each language?

Not necessarily. Advanced platforms now offer multi-track exports where viewers can select their preferred audio language while watching the same visual content. This reduces storage needs by up to 80% for multilingual libraries.
